Публикации по теме 'useeffect'
От новичка до эксперта: подробное руководство по использованию эффектов в React
React — это популярная библиотека JavaScript для создания пользовательских интерфейсов, а ее API-интерфейс хуков позволяет разработчикам использовать состояние и другие функции React без написания компонента класса. Одним из наиболее полезных хуков является useEffect , который позволяет функциональному компоненту выполнять побочные эффекты, такие как выполнение вызовов API или изменение модели DOM.
Если вы новичок в React или опытный разработчик, желающий улучшить свои знания..
useEffect против useLayoutEffect
useEffect против useLayoutEffect
useEffect и useLayoutEffect – это два хука React, которые используются для управления побочными эффектами в компоненте React. Вот различия между двумя крючками:
Время: useEffect выполняется после того, как браузер отрисовывает компонент и обновляет DOM, а useLayoutEffect выполняется до того, как браузер обновляет экран. Это означает, что useLayoutEffect более синхронизирован, чем useEffect . Случаи использования . useEffect..
React Hooks - понимание основ
React Conf, 2018 стал свидетелем значительного появления в мире React - «ловушек» (доступных с v16.8.0 ), которые теперь позволяют нам использовать функции компонентов с отслеживанием состояния. в функциональных компонентах. Хуки - это в основном функции, которые позволяют нам включать функции состояния реакции и жизненного цикла без использования классов и организовывать логику внутри компонента в повторно используемые изолированные блоки.
Мы постоянно стремимся совершенствовать..
Вариант использования React useEffect Hook
Что React говорит о хуке useEffect -
Что делает useEffect ? Используя этот хук, вы сообщаете React, что ваш компонент должен что-то сделать после рендеринга. React запомнит переданную вами функцию (мы будем называть ее нашим «эффектом ) и вызовет ее позже после выполнения обновлений DOM».
Вопрос в том, как мы узнаем, где мы используем хук useEffect?
Хук useEffect управляет всеми тремя состояниями жизненного цикла реакции -
Монтаж
Обновление
Размонтирование..
Как работает useEffect
В новейшей версии React вам не нужно создавать компонент класса для поддержания состояния. Есть много статей и разговоров о том, почему выгодно избавиться от классовой компоненты и использовать функциональные компоненты. Это обсуждение выходит за рамки этого поста, поэтому я бы порекомендовал, если вы хотите узнать и понять суть решения о включении состояний и (подобных) методов жизненного цикла в функциональные компоненты, вам следует прочитать/просмотреть их.
Для простоты я не буду..
Как использовать хук useEffect
Добро пожаловать, читатель еще одного блога, где я пытаюсь объяснить текущую тему в мире разработки программного обеспечения. В предыдущем блоге я рассказал о том, как использовать React Hooks, в частности, useState . Если вы хотите прочитать этот блог и узнать больше о хуке useState, нажмите здесь . В этом блоге основное внимание будет уделено, вероятно, второй по важности ловушке - ловушке useEffect .
useEffect Hook
Назначение ловушки useEffect - позволить вам выполнять..
Реагировать на крючки
React — это ориентированная на дизайн библиотека, используемая для создания интерактивных веб-приложений, где элементы DOM перезагружаются только при внесении изменений. Это называется дифференциальной перезагрузкой. Это полезно, когда вам нужны интерактивные и динамические элементы DOM.
Ранее React был простой библиотекой внешнего интерфейса, которая использовалась только для того, чтобы все выглядело красиво. Требовался модуль с состоянием, такой как Flux или Redux, чтобы..